Initiation à la programmation avec Python et C++

Apprenez simplement les bases de la programmation

  • Nombre de pages : 312 pages
  • Date de parution : 18/03/2011 (2e édition)

Résumé

Une introduction à la programmation objet en général, présentant aussi bien les aspects des langages interprétés (Python) que ceux des langages compilés (C++). Chaque problématique est systématiquement illustrée dans les deux langages, établissant ainsi un parallèle efficace et pédagogique.

L'ouvrage s'articule autour de la réalisation d'un petit programme, le jeu des Tours de Hanoï. Il présente les concepts de bases, les techniques de programmation, la création d'interfaces graphiques attrayantes et les outils facilitant la programmation (bibliothèques, IDE, etc...). Une dernière partie fournit des pistes pour aider à poursuivre son apprentissage.

Principales nouveautés de la 2e édition :

  • Mise à niveau des langages, en particulier Python (v. 2.5 > v. 3.1, différences importantes), et informations pour systèmes PC-BSD.
  • Refonte complète des chapitres consacrés à l'affichage graphique, en particulier le dessin par éléments structurés et une introduction détaillée à OpenGL pour un affichage 3D.
  • Un chapitre consacré aux IDE (environnements de développement intégrés), lesquels permettent en programmation d'automatiser de nombreuses tâches.
  • Codes sources en ligne.

Sommaire

  • Mise en place
  • Stockage de l'information : les variables
  • Des programmes dans un programme : les fonctions
  • L'interactivité : échanger avec l'utilisateur
  • Ronds-points et embranchements : boucles et alternatives
  • Des variables composées
  • Les Tours de Hanoï
  • Le monde modélisé : la programmation orientée objet (POO)
  • Hanoï en objets
  • Mise en abîme : la récursivité
  • Spécificités propres au C++
  • Ouverture des fenêtres : programmation graphique
  • Hanoï graphique
  • Du dessin structuré
  • Stockage de masse : manipuler les fichiers
  • Le temps qui passe
  • Rassembler et diffuser : les bibliothèques
  • Introduction à OpenGL
  • Hanoï en 3D
  • Des idées et des EDI
  • Aperçu d'autres langages

Caractéristiques

  • Parution : 18/03/2011
  • Edition : 2e édition
  •  
  • Nb de pages : 312 pages
  • Format : 19 x 23
  • Couverture : Broché
  • Poids : 660 g
  • Intérieur : Noir et Blanc
  •  

mentions légales | conditions générales de vente | copyright © 2012
(1) livraison gratuite à partir de 49 € en France métropolitaine